PERSONALITY | Budhu Bhagat





                                                           The Hero of the



                                                           Larka Rebellion



                                                            Budhu Bhagat, the leader of the Larka rebellion
                                                            and a visionary freedom fighter, waged guerrilla
                                                             war against the British and moneylenders for
                                                               independence. He awakened the people of
                                                             the Chorea, Pithoria, Lohardaga, and Palamu
                                                             regions to fight for freedom from British rule.
                                                             He fought tooth and nail against exploitation
                                                              and oppression. He chased the British out of
                                                            the forests for many years and taught the tribal
                                                            people to fight against injustice. Budhu Bhagat,
                                                            an epitome of courage, resistance, bravery, and
